1. Create a LinkedIn or Facebook Article
Take your blog post and rewrite it into a long-form article tailored for platforms like LinkedIn or Facebook Notes. Use a slightly different headline, trim any overly technical content, and format it for easy reading.
This is ideal for:
-
Reaching professional or community audiences
-
Driving engagement through comments and shares
-
Establishing authority in your niche
Be sure to add a CTA (call-to-action) linking back to your original blog post or website.
2. Break It into Social Media Posts
Each section or subheading of your blog can become its own standalone social media post. Pull out key insights, tips, or stats and turn them into bite-sized captions for:
-
Instagram
-
Facebook
-
Twitter/X
-
LinkedIn
Add a relevant image or branded visual to boost attention. A single blog can generate 4–6 different posts depending on its length and content depth.
3. Design an Infographic
If your blog includes steps, comparisons, statistics, or processes, convert the core ideas into an eye-catching infographic. Tools like Canva, Venngage, or Adobe Express make this process easy—even for beginners.
Infographics are great for:
-
Visual learners
-
Pinterest sharing
-
LinkedIn and B2B lead generation
-
Adding visual value to newsletters
They also increase your chances of backlinks when other sites share your graphic.
4. Turn It into a Video Script
Use the blog as a base to write a script for a short-form video. This could be a 60-second Instagram Reel, YouTube Short, or TikTok. You can summarize the blog’s key point or highlight a specific tip or insight.
Videos increase engagement dramatically and allow your audience to connect with your brand face-to-face (or voice-to-voice).

6. Send a Newsletter Highlight
Your email list deserves valuable content too! Summarize your blog post into a short, punchy newsletter that links to the full post.
Make sure your subject line is engaging, and use bullet points or visuals to make the content scannable. It’s a great way to drive repeat traffic to your site and build loyalty with subscribers.
7. Create a Carousel Post
On platforms like Instagram and LinkedIn, carousels allow you to share multiple slides in a single post. Take the main takeaways from your blog and turn each into a slide. End with a CTA slide encouraging readers to visit the full blog or your website.
8. Develop a Downloadable PDF or Guide
If your blog is educational or instructional, convert it into a downloadable lead magnet. Add some visuals, polish the formatting, and offer it as a freebie in exchange for email sign-ups.

9. Use It as a Podcast or Audio Topic
If your brand runs a podcast—or plans to—use the blog post as an outline for a solo episode. You can expand on the topic, share real-life examples, or interview someone who can offer additional insight.
Even without a full podcast setup, you can record audio snippets and share them on social media or your website.
10. Update It into a Series
If the original blog performs well, break it into a blog series. Dive deeper into subtopics and create spin-off posts that expand on individual points. Internally link each post for better SEO and user experience.
This helps create a content cluster that strengthens your authority on a specific topic.
